Output 8abaa6436e2a6b0c981261c88128927ddcfaa4258979718e3810e6c0a0b9940f:0

value
70798149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d683d286f7554481ef8b258d8eaa1d286cd211b OP_EQUAL
address
MLnrP893ubr8a7vqg13YvzyxyDP3My9kgQ
transaction
8abaa6436e2a6b0c981261c88128927ddcfaa4258979718e3810e6c0a0b9940f
spent
true